The basic unit of printing in WinForms is the print document. A print document describes the characteristics of what's to be printed, such as the title of the document, and provides the events at various parts of the printing process, such as when it's time to print a page. .NET models the print document using the PrintDocument component from the System.Drawing. Printing namespace (and available on the VS.NET Toolbox):
